US secretary of state Antony Blinken has met Russian foreign minister Sergei Lavrov for the first time since the Kremlin launched its full-scale invasion of Ukraine last year.
Blinken and Lavrov spoke for about 10 minutes on the sidelines of a meeting of G20 foreign ministers in New Delhi on Thursday, according to a state department official.
The official said Blinken told Lavrov that Washington would support Ukraine for as long as it took and that Russia should reverse its recent decision to suspend participation in New Start, the last remaining nuclear arms control treaty between the two powers.
